Most Searched Online Schools In New Mexico 2024 Tuition Comparison

For the academic year 2023-2024, the average tuition & fees of Most Searched Online Schools In New Mexico is $3,701 for in-state and $13,450 for out-of-state. St. John's College has the most expensive tuition & fees of $38,946 and Navajo Technical University has the lowest tuition & fees of $4,250 among Most Searched Online Schools In New Mexico.
The average itemized cost for Most Searched Online Schools In New Mexico is as follows.
  • Tuition & Fees is $3,701 for state residents and $13,450 for out-of-state.
  • Cost per credit hour is $127 for state residents and $440 for out-of-state.
  • Boos & supplies cost is $1,390.
  • Living cost is $10,728 (on-campus), $11,262 (off-campus).
